#cc822e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cc822e is composed of 80% red, 51%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 36.3% magenta, 77.5%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 31.9 degrees, a saturation of 63.2% and a lightness of 49%. #cc822e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ff5c with #990500.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

Shades and Tints of #cc822e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0803 is the darkest color, while #fefd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#cc822e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7f7d7b is the less saturated color, while #f28408 is the most saturated one.
